This year's incarnation of the Fiesta Van has been launched by Ford, with the vehicle manufacturer hoping the model will continue to make a big splash in the coming 12 months.
Featuring a number of new innovations to boost safety and security – such as the model's Active City Stop, Emergency Assistance and MyKey systems – the Fiesta Van is likely to prove popular among urban buyers.
Furthermore, its emissions and fuel efficiency of 87 g/km of O2 and 85.6 mpg are best-in-class.
"The new Fiesta Van is a stylish mobile workshop for light duty tools and equipment that makes great business sense," commented Mark Easton, Ford Britain light commercial vehicle product manager.
Last autumn, Ford also unveiled its newest Transit model to the eager UK public, with the vehicle making its global debut at the Hanover IAA Commercial Vehicle Show.
The new Transit has proven popular so far, delivering a ten per cent increase in cargo capacity and a new range of power options for buyers.
